Fourth transmembrane domain (TMD4) within the context of the proton-coupled folate transporter (PCFT) topological structure: partial sequence alignment of PCFT among species. A: PCFT topology has been established by the substituted Cys accessibility method (SCAM) (43). TMD4 is magnified. Leu146 and Ser167 are at the extracellular and intracellular interfaces, respectively. These residues and the residues between them were evaluated by the SCAM. Two residues mutated in subjects with hereditary folate malabsorption, G147R and D156Y, are indicated. B: human PCFT TMD4 protein sequence was aligned with 9 different species. PRALINE sequence alignment program (http://www.ibi.vu.nl/programs/) was utilized. Numbers above the sequence are derived from human PCFT.
